FEATURES

E-mail: sales@taychipst.com MAXIMUM RATINGS AND ELECTRICAL CHARACTERISTICS MECHANICAL DATA SURFACE MOUNT SCHOTTKY BARRIER RECTIFIER

  • Plastic Package has Underwriters Laboratory Flammability Classification 94V-0
  • Metal silicon junction, majority carrier conduction
  • Guard ring for overvoltage protection
  • Low power loss, high efficiency
  • High current capability, Low forward voltage drop
  • High surge capability
  • For use in low voltage, high frequency inverters, free wheeling, and polarity protection applications
  • High temperature soldering guaranteed : 250¡É/10 seconds at terminals, 0.375" (9.5mm) lead length, 5lbs. (2.3Kg) tension
  • Case : JEDEC DO-201AD molded plastic body
  • Terminals : Plated axial leads, solderable per MIL-STD-750, Method 2026
  • Polarity : Color band denotes cathode end
  • Mounting Position : Any
